What Is a Network Switch with Fiber Port?

A network switch with fiber port is a managed or unmanaged switch that includes one or more fiber-optic interfaces alongside traditional Ethernet ports. These fiber ports (often SFP/SFP+ slots) allow network traffic to travel over fiber-optic cabling, enabling:

  • Extended reach fiber supports much greater distances than copper Ethernet

  • High bandwidth ideal for backbone links and high-traffic segments

  • Improved reliability immunity to electromagnetic interference

  • Scalability easy integration into hybrid copper-fiber environments

Fiber ports make it possible to interconnect network segments across buildings, floors, or campuses without signal degradation.

Key Benefits of a Network Switch with Fiber Port

1. Long-Distance Connectivity

Fiber connections easily bridge long distances where copper Ethernet can’t perfect for connecting buildings, data centers, or remote equipment without signal loss.

2. High Bandwidth Performance

Fiber-optic ports support higher data rates, making them ideal for bandwidth-intensive applications like virtualization, video streaming, and large-scale data transfers.

3. Reduced Interference

Unlike copper, fiber is immune to electromagnetic interference an advantage in industrial and high-density network environments.

4. Future-Proof Networking

With fiber infrastructure in place, your network is ready to support next-generation technologies and bandwidth demands with minimal upgrades.

Common Use Cases

Network switches with fiber ports are widely used across various environments:

  • Enterprise networks backbone connectivity and inter-floor links

  • Campus and multi-building networks long-distance fiber backhaul

  • Data centers high-speed, high-capacity connectivity

  • Industrial facilities robust networking with extended distance reach

  • Telecommunications and service provider networks scalable fiber deployments

In each of these settings, combining traditional Ethernet with fiber ports creates a flexible and powerful network architecture.
